Plot: Michael is on a rail journey across the southern coast of England, beginning in Dorset. He takes to the water in Portland Harbour and hears the story of the Tolpuddle Martyrs
Great Coastal Railway Journeys - Season 2 - Weymouth to Lulworth (Episode 16)
Episode Aired On:
Monday, June 12 2023
1 year ago
Monday, June 12 2023
1 year ago